[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I lost 100 pounds by diet alone. It took me a year. I did no exercise (none)! But it required a wholesale change in my eating habits. No snacking, only three meals a day, and cutting out flour and sugar. It's totally possible, but you have to be very disciplined to lose weight by diet alone.[/quote] I have lost 10 pounds in the last months by switching to 3 (reasonable) meals a day. Obviously snacking was a big issue to me. I am no longer trying to decide between low carb or low fat or low sugar. I just eat 3 reasonably portioned meals. Of course getting rid of snacks got rid of lots of carbs and sugar..[/quote]
